在信息化时代,法院作为国家司法体系的重要组成部分,其办案效率的高低直接关系到司法公正和人民群众的满意度。近年来,随着大数据、人工智能等先进技术的快速发展,法院系统开始探索如何利用科技力量提升办案效率。本文将揭秘法院大数据办案效率提升的秘籍,探讨如何让案件审理更加高效。
大数据在法院办案中的应用
1. 案件信息管理
利用大数据技术,法院可以对案件信息进行统一管理,实现案件信息的快速检索、分类、归档等功能。通过建立案件信息数据库,法官可以方便地查询相关案例、法律法规,提高办案效率。
# 示例:使用Python代码创建案件信息数据库
import sqlite3
# 创建数据库连接
conn = sqlite3.connect('case_info.db')
cursor = conn.cursor()
# 创建案件信息表
cursor.execute('''
CREATE TABLE IF NOT EXISTS case_info (
case_id INTEGER PRIMARY KEY,
case_name TEXT,
case_type TEXT,
case_status TEXT,
judge_name TEXT,
create_time TEXT
)
''')
# 插入案件信息
cursor.execute('''
INSERT INTO case_info (case_id, case_name, case_type, case_status, judge_name, create_time)
VALUES (1, '张三诉李四合同纠纷案', '民事', '审理中', '王法官', '2023-01-01')
''')
# 提交事务
conn.commit()
# 关闭数据库连接
conn.close()
2. 智能辅助办案
通过大数据分析,法院可以实现对案件类型的预测、风险评估等功能,为法官提供智能辅助办案。例如,利用机器学习算法对案件进行分类,帮助法官快速了解案件类型,提高审判效率。
# 示例:使用Python代码进行案件分类
from sklearn.feature_extraction.text import CountVectorizer
from sklearn.naive_bayes import MultinomialNB
# 加载案件数据
case_data = [
'张三诉李四合同纠纷案',
'王五诉赵六侵权纠纷案',
'李四诉张三离婚纠纷案'
]
# 创建向量器
vectorizer = CountVectorizer()
# 创建分类器
classifier = MultinomialNB()
# 将案件数据转换为向量
X = vectorizer.fit_transform(case_data)
# 训练分类器
classifier.fit(X, [0, 1, 2])
# 预测新案件类型
new_case = '赵六诉钱七财产纠纷案'
new_case_vector = vectorizer.transform([new_case])
predicted_type = classifier.predict(new_case_vector)[0]
print('预测案件类型:', predicted_type)
3. 优化审判流程
大数据技术可以帮助法院优化审判流程,提高案件审理效率。例如,通过分析案件审理周期、法官工作量等数据,法院可以合理分配法官资源,提高审判效率。
提升法院大数据办案效率的关键
1. 加强数据基础设施建设
为了更好地应用大数据技术,法院需要加强数据基础设施建设,包括数据采集、存储、处理等方面。同时,要确保数据安全,防止数据泄露。
2. 提高法官信息化素养
法官作为法院办案的主体,需要具备一定的信息化素养。通过培训、学习等方式,提高法官对大数据、人工智能等技术的了解和应用能力。
3. 完善相关法律法规
为了保障大数据在法院办案中的应用,需要完善相关法律法规,明确数据采集、使用、共享等方面的规定,确保数据安全和司法公正。
总之,利用大数据技术提升法院办案效率是信息化时代司法改革的重要方向。通过加强数据基础设施建设、提高法官信息化素养、完善相关法律法规等措施,法院可以更好地发挥科技力量,实现案件审理的高效、公正。
